bei onclick JavaScript Funktion aufrufen
kleener Mann
- javascript
0 Struppi0 kleener Mann0 Struppi
0 kleener Mann0 Struppi0 Axel Richter0 Cheatah
Hallo
Ich habe folgenden Code, der mir bei drücken eines Buttons
einen Text rot färben soll:
im Head Bereich
------------------
<script language="javascript">
<!--
function checkInformation {
window.memberinfo._zuname.innerHTML = "<font face='Arial' style='color: red'>Zuname (*)</font>";
}
// -->
</script>
-------------------
Im Body:
-------------------
<span name='_zuname'>Zuname (*)</span>
<input type='button' onclick='javascript:checkInformation()' value='Weiter zu Schritt 3'>
das Memberinfo ist nur der Name der Form wo der Span drinne vorkommt
Wieso funktinoiert das nicht
Cu
kleener Mann
Hallo
Ich habe folgenden Code, der mir bei drücken eines Buttons
einen Text rot färben soll:
im Head Bereich<script language="javascript">
<!--
function checkInformation {
window.memberinfo._zuname.innerHTML = "<font face='Arial' style='color: red'>Zuname (*)</font>";
}
// -->
</script>Im Body:
<span name='_zuname'>Zuname (*)</span>
<input type='button' onclick='javascript:checkInformation()' value='Weiter zu Schritt 3'>das Memberinfo ist nur der Name der Form wo der Span drinne vorkommt
Wieso funktinoiert das nicht
1. Benutzt du einen ungültigen Namen
2. Benutzt du das IE 4 Objektmodel
3. Benutzt du veraltete HMTL Tags
Vielleicht liest du dich erstmal du die Kapitel über Javascript und CSS bei selfthml.
Struppi.
auf solche scheiss antworten kannst du auch verzichten.
Da steht alles drin, was man wissen muss um mir zu helfen, aber solche kommentare kannst du dir sparen...
kleener Mann
auf solche scheiss antworten kannst du auch verzichten.
Ball flachhalten und Gehirn einschalten!
Da steht alles drin, was man wissen muss um mir zu helfen, aber solche kommentare kannst du dir sparen...
Wieso?
Was hast du an meiner Hilfe nicht verstanden?
Ist da irgendwas falsch gewesen?
Struppi.
Ich hatte die beiden Klammern vergessen, aber es geht immernoch nicht. Er sagt jezt er kenne window.memberinfo._zuname nicht ?
Was tun
kleener Mann
Ich hatte die beiden Klammern vergessen, aber es geht immernoch nicht. Er sagt jezt er kenne window.memberinfo._zuname nicht ?
Sagt ich dir bereist, weil der Name falsch ist, aber da du jemand zu sein scheinst, der alles vorgelesen bekommen möchte, bitte:
http://www.netzwelt.com/selfhtml/javascript/sprache/regeln.htm#namen
Der abschnitt nach:
"Bei selbst vergebenen Namen gelten folgende Regeln:"
ist für dich relevant. Dort findest du noch weitere Informationen.
Darüber hinaus ist das für dich interessant: http://www.netzwelt.com/selfhtml/dhtml/modelle/index.htm
Und wenn du nicht in der Lage bist mit solchen informationen etwas anzufangen, dann frag bitte nicht hier. Aber schieb deine Unfähikeit nicht auf mich, danke.
Struppi.
Ich hatte die beiden Klammern vergessen, aber es geht immernoch nicht. Er sagt jezt er kenne window.memberinfo._zuname nicht ?
Was tun
Lesen!
Ist das Formular "memberinfo" ein Unterobjekt von window? Nein.
http://selfhtml.teamone.de/javascript/objekte/window.htm
Ist name ein zulässiges Atribut für einen span? Nein.
http://selfhtml.teamone.de/html/referenz/attribute.htm#span
Wie kann ein Element über seine ID, denn das ist ein Universalattribut, also auch in span erlaubt, angesprochen werden?
http://selfhtml.teamone.de/javascript/objekte/document.htm#get_element_by_id
viele Grüße
Axel
Danke aber es geht immernoch nicht. Er sagt,
innerHTML sei kein gültiges Attribut für Span. Ich habs
mal mit DIV probiert geht aber auch nicht. Wie mache ich
das denn nun ?
Danke aber es geht immernoch nicht. Er sagt,
innerHTML sei kein gültiges Attribut für Span. Ich habs
mal mit DIV probiert geht aber auch nicht. Wie mache ich
das denn nun ?
Indem Du nicht versuchst den gesamten HTML-Inhalt des span zu verändern, sondern nur die CSS-Eigenschaft color?
http://selfhtml.teamone.de/javascript/objekte/style.htm#allgemeines
http://selfhtml.teamone.de/javascript/objekte/style.htm#style_eigenschaften
viele Grüße
Axel
Hi,
Er sagt jezt er kenne window.memberinfo._zuname nicht ?
ich kenne bereits window.memberinfo nicht. Und ich wette, Dein Browser findet das ziemlich undefiniert, wenn Du es Dir mal raus-alert()est.
Cheatah